Node.js性能优化之CPU篇

Node.js性能优化之CPU篇,第1张

这时,会在/tmp目录下生成 /tmp/perf-3456map , 即 perf-进程idmap

perf record 会将记录的信息保存到当前执行目录的 perfdata 文件中

使用 perf script 读取 perfdata 的 trace 信息写入 perfstacks。

--color=js 指定生成针对 JavaScript 配色的 svg,即:

浏览器打开 flamegraphsvg

生成 cpuprofile-xxxcpuprofile 文件,该文件的内容其实就是一个大的 JSON 对象

Chrome 自带了分析 CPU profile 日志的工具。打开 Chrome -> 调出开发者工具(DevTools) -> 单击右上角三个点的按钮 -> More tools -> JavaScript Profiler -> Load,加载刚才生成的 cpuprofile 文件。

首先全局安装 flamegraph 模块:

运行以下命令将 cpuprofile 文件生成 svg 文件:

用浏览器打开 cpuprofilesvg,如下所示:

如果JS只是在系统上面修改系统信息的话用EVEREST可以测出来,若是一些旧的电脑,如P4

还有K7哪些的话JS可以通过刷主板BIOS将低端的刷成较高端的,硬盘也可以用刷容量法加大容量,实际上可用容量不变,至于内存这个没办法动手的,只能从系统信息上修改,用EVEREST就可以,至于一些二手显卡要注意了,好多JS都是用刷BIOS的方式改了显卡的名称,实际上你也可以用GPU-Z测出来,旬括GPU,频率,显存大小等等

您好,您的问题是:JS 可以过去 CPU 架构吗?答案是肯定的。JS 是一种跨平台的编程语言,它可以在不同的架构上运行,包括 CPU 架构。JS 可以在多种 CPU 架构上运行,包括 x86,ARM,MIPS 和其他架构。JS 可以在各种 *** 作系统上运行,包括 Windows,Linux,Mac OS X,Android 和 iOS。因此,JS 可以在 CPU 架构上运行,并且可以在不同的 *** 作系统上运行,从而支持多种 CPU 架构。

JS检测指纹是一个越来越流行的Web安全技术,通过监测用户浏览器的各种属性和行为,确定用户的唯一标识,以防止恶意行为的发生。下面是一些JS检测指纹可能会检测的属性和行为:

1 浏览器的User-Agent

2 IP地址

3 地理位置

4 *** 作系统和硬件信息

5 是否启用了隐私保护和广告拦截插件

6 是否启用了JavaScript和Cookies

7 浏览器窗口大小和位置

8 网络速度和延迟

9 时间戳

10 鼠标轨迹和点击行为

11 键盘输入行为

需要注意的是,JS检测指纹是一项涉及隐私的技术,检测结果可能会被用于不道德的追踪、分析和推销行为。用户可以通过禁用JavaScript、使用隐私保护插件和***等方式,保护自己的隐私和个人信息。

以上就是关于Node.js性能优化之CPU篇全部的内容,包括:Node.js性能优化之CPU篇、如何查看电脑内存硬盘及CPU主频是否被JS修改过、js可以过去cpu架构吗等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/web/9745674.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-01
下一篇 2023-05-01

发表评论

登录后才能评论

评论列表(0条)

保存